Systemd使用

Systemd是Linux操作系统的系统和服务管理器,用来启动守护进程。目前多数Linux发行版都已经采用Systemd取代了initd,作为整个系统的守护进程,成为系统第一个进程(PID为1,其他进程都是他的子进程)。他的设计目的是为了让进程并发启动,按需启动进程,提高Linux系统启动速度,让使用也更简洁。 Systemd跟initd的使用对比: # initd使用 /etc/init.d/nginx start # 或 service nginx start # systemd使用 systemctl start nginx systemctl命令 systemctl命令是Systemd中最重要的一个命令,用于对进程进行启动,停止等管理操作。 命令格式 systemctl [command] [unit] 例如: systemctl start nginx.service # 或 systemctl start nginx command 说明 start 开启 stop 关闭

Git常用命令

名词解释 * Workspace : 工作区 * Index / Stage : 暂存区 * Repository : 仓库区(或本地仓库) * Remote : 远程仓库 一. 新建代码库 # 在当前目录新建一个Git代码库 $ git init # 新建一个目录,将其初始化为Git代码库 $ git init [project-name] # 下载一个项目和它的整个代码历史 $ git clone [url] 二.配置 Git的设置文件为.gitconfig,它可以在用户主目录下(全局配置),也可以在项目目录下(项目配置) # 显示当前的Git配置 $ git config --list # 编辑Git配置文件 $ git config -e [--global] # 设置提交代码时的用户信息 $ git config [--global] user.name "[name]" $ git